Ingredients for 4 servings:
- 4 chicken breast fillets, approx. 175 g each
- ½ lemon(s), grated zest and juice
- ½ orange(s), grated peel and juice
- 2 tbsp honey, liquid
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 2 tbsp mint, freshly chopped
- salt and pepper
Instructions
Working time approx. 30 minutes; Rest time approx. 8 hours; Cooking/baking time approx. 10 minutes; Total time approx. 8 hours 40 minutes
for the grill
Wash the chicken and pat dry. Using a sharp knife, cut into 2.5 cm cubes and place in a bowl. Combine the zest and juice of the lemon and orange in a small bowl with the oil, honey, and mint; mix.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Pour the marinade over the meat and mix thoroughly.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and marinate the meat in the refrigerator for 8 hours. Heat the grill. Drain the chicken cubes and reserve the marinade. Thread the meat onto several long metal or wooden skewers. If using wooden skewers, soak them in water first. Do not place the meat cubes too close together on the skewers, otherwise they will not cook evenly and will remain raw in the center. Grill the skewers over medium heat for 6-10 minutes, turning frequently and brushing with the marinade. Arrange on a serving platter and serve.
